How Big Is A Miniature Cow?

WebThe exact height and weight of an adult mini highland cow will depend on its sex and the maturity of its growth. The average height of an adult mini Highland cow ranges between 36 – 41 inches at the shoulder, while the average weight of a mature cow is between 500 – 700 pounds. Miniature Highland cattle generally mature at two years old ... WebA mini cow is a miniature breed of cattle. Miniature cattle are those breeds with an adult weight of 400 kilograms (880 lb) or less. The mini cows weight can range from 150 to 250 kg (330 to 550 lb). There are many breeds of mini cows available including Dexter Highland Shetland and Tiny Texan. Web4 de jun. de 2024 · Miniature Cattle Breeds ~ Size of Miniature Cows. Midsize miniature cows measure from 42 to 48 inches at the hip. Standard miniature cows range from 36 to 42 inches. Micro-miniature cows are all less than 36 inches in height at the hip. Do mini cows stay small?
